4. There are dry mud tubes on your foundation

We’re not done talking about termites, so stay here for a moment, because these instincts are synonyms with home problems. If you discover any dry and small tubes on the foundation of your home, and these dots run from the ground to your siding, you could say that your home is the victim of an active infestation.

These insects are subterranean creatures, and they don’t like people to see them doing their “job”. This means that they prefer to stay covered during dinner when they travel back and forth from their refuge spot in the soil to the feast in your home.

To camouflage their paths, they build tiny tunnels, which are roughly 1/4 inch wide. If you have an active infestation, you’ll see these tunnels on the inside or outside of your foundation.

If you notice a crawl space, grab a good flashlight, take a look in the crevice, and check for tubes at least once a year. And if there’s something suspicious, call an exterminator.
